Do mutations in body cells contribute to genetic variation?.
lozanna [386]

Answer:

Yes

Explanation:

Mutations contribute to genetic variation within species. Mutations can also be inherited, particularly if they have a positive effect. For example, the disorder sickle cell anaemia is caused by a mutation in the gene that instructs the building of a protein called hemoglobin.
